The Mechanics of Clinical Efficacy
Precise Targeting via the Photothermal Effect
The core mechanism of these systems relies on the photothermal effect. The device emits a specific wavelength of coherent light that is selectively absorbed by the melanin in the hair.
This absorption converts light energy into heat. The heat is sufficient to destroy the hair follicle's ability to regenerate without causing thermal damage to the surrounding tissue.
Achieving Long-Term Reduction
Unlike temporary methods like shaving or waxing, professional lasers target the biological source of growth. By disabling the regenerative capacity of the follicle, these systems provide a long-term solution.
This efficacy is what differentiates a medical-grade treatment from cosmetic concealments, making it a staple service for patients seeking permanent results.

The Technical Edge: Why "Professional" Matters
High-Power Semiconductor Architecture
Professional-grade equipment distinguishes itself through the use of high-power semiconductor laser bars.
These components deliver superior power density and ensure wavelength stability (commonly 808nm). This technical stability is critical for consistent clinical outcomes across different patients.
Speed and Efficiency
The high power density of professional systems allows for faster treatment times per session.
This efficiency is crucial for clinic throughput, allowing practitioners to treat more patients per day while maintaining a relatively painless experience compared to lower-powered alternatives.
Understanding the Trade-offs
Complexity and Maintenance
While professional systems offer superior results, they rely on complex components like high-performance laser bars.
This complexity requires rigorous maintenance schedules to ensure wavelength stability. Neglecting calibration can lead to reduced efficacy or safety risks.
Operator Expertise Required
High-power systems are not "plug-and-play" in the same way consumer devices are.
Because these devices deliver potent energy to achieve the photothermal effect, they require skilled operators to adjust settings for different skin types to avoid burns or ineffective treatment.
